

Touch Football South Australia is proud to announce and support our SA Heat Men's Open team as they head to the 2025 National Touch League in Coffs Harbour. Representing our state on the national stage is an incredible achievement, and we wish the team the very best as they compete against the top talent from across the country.
We know they will do us proud both on and off the field. Good luck to all the players, coaches, and support staff.

A Special Thank You to Our SA Heat Women's Open Team
We also want to take a moment to thank and acknowledge the SA Heat Women’s Open team. Unfortunately, due to the rescheduling of the tournament, our women's team is unable to participate in this year's Championships.
